How to Compress PDF Size to 20kb

Compressing your PDF files to a smaller size can be useful in various situations, such as when you need to send them via email or upload them to a website. With pdfFiller's Compress PDF Size to 20kb feature, you can easily reduce the file size without compromising the quality of your documents. Follow these simple steps to compress your PDF files to 20kb:

01
Open the pdfFiller website or app and log in to your account.
02
Click on the 'MyBox' tab to access your stored documents.
03
Select the PDF file you want to compress by clicking on it.
04
Once the file is open, click on the 'More' button located at the top right corner of the screen.
05
From the drop-down menu, choose the 'Compress PDF Size' option.
06
In the pop-up window, you will see a slider that allows you to adjust the compression level. Slide it to the left to decrease the file size.
07
As you adjust the slider, you will notice the estimated file size displayed below it. Keep sliding until it reaches around 20kb.
08
Once you are satisfied with the compression level, click on the 'Compress' button.
09
Wait for the compression process to complete. This may take a few moments depending on the size of your PDF file and your internet connection speed.
10
After the compression is finished, you will be prompted to save the compressed PDF file. Choose a location on your device or cloud storage and click 'Save'.
11
Congratulations! You have successfully compressed your PDF file to 20kb using pdfFiller's Compress PDF Size feature.
